+\centerline{\bf Recharging Toner Cartridges}
+\medskip
+\noindent
+It is possible to have your old laser printer
+toner cartridges refilled. PPI will recharge
+a carrtridge for the Canon LBP-CX engine for
+\quid45.00. This is substantially cheaper than
+buying a new one. And they put more toner
+in than you had the first time. It appears that
+cartridges can be refilled many times, but of course
+they insist that the cartridge must be in good
+condition. If you want to be more colourful, that
+costs more --- they charge \quid55.00 for a colour
+refill (you can put a colour refill in a cartridge
+which had black toner). They will refill single
+cartridges, and also offer
+discounts for bulk, offereing a discount of 20\%
+on quantities of 50.
+The Canon engine is the heart of many
+a laser printer, including the HP LaserJet,
+the LaserWriter, QMS800 and Imagen, to
+name but a few. For further information:

+\centerline{\bf Bulletin Board}
+\medskip
+\noindent
+Personal \TeX, suppliers of pc\TeX\ and an
+increasing number of other quality \TeX\ add-ons
+have a bulletin board for their users. Its contents
+read a bit like \hax, but there is quite clearly
+a fair amount of self-help going on. There are
+a number of files available for downloading,
+including some utilities. Among the files
+are the sources of the Boston Computer Society
+\TeX\ benchmarks.
+
+I have had a look through some synopses which
+\DW\ provided, and include a taste of
+the material present.
+
+There was an account
+of the meeting of German \TeX\ users in Heidelberg
+in October 1986. Norbert Schwarz has developed another set
+of German hyphenation patterns which are said
+to be better (linguistically), and to take up
+less room than those of Bernd Schulze.
+The Schulze hyphenation patterns are available
+through Personal \TeX. Personal \TeX\ will
+also be releasing Michael Ferguson's multi-lingual
+\TeX, which allows simultaneous multi-lingual
+hyphenation. They give June\slash July 1987 as a release date,
+but I don't believe them.
+
+Those who read TUG will also know of the Portugese
+hyphenation patterns from Pedro de Rezende, which
+may by now be part of some \TeX\ distribution
+tapes.
+
+This is quite a lively bulletin board, and it seems
+to go some way to providing an alternative to
+\hax\ for those without academic networks to back
+them up. The only real problem I see is
+the expense of transatlantic telephone calls.
+If this sort of service is a feature of Personal \TeX s
+commitment to \TeX, then it bodes well for them and us.
